David Thomson
CEO & Founder, Suada
David Thomson grew up mixed-race in 1970s Britain, and that story is the one he tells on Life by Misadventure. In business he built a company with a 200-person call centre, and when Google's 2008 algorithm change silenced it overnight, the rebuild taught him how ordinary people really learn. Today he is CEO and founder of Suada, a learning retention platform used by DNV, one of the world's leading certification bodies. He was formerly one of only six people in the world certified to teach both of Dr Robert Cialdini's influence workshops, the Principles of Persuasion and the Pre-Suasion workshop, a certification he has since given up by choice.
